
Maia Sandu discussed access to financing for the private sector with representatives of Banca Transilvania, the largest shareholder of Victoriabank
According to the press service of the head of state, in particular, President met with the CEO of the Romanian Banca Transilvania, Ömer Tetik, and the Deputy CEO of Banca Transilvania on legal issues and former CEO of Victoriabank, Bogdan Plesuvescu. Banca Transilvania, the largest banking group in Romania, holds a controlling stake in Victoriabank. During the discussions, Moldovan President emphasized the importance of Victoriabank in supporting small and medium-sized businesses by providing access to financing, which is an important factor for their growth and creation of well-paid jobs. At the same time, the head of state reiterated the government's commitment to improve the investment climate and to promote the judicial reforms needed to ensure a stable and predictable economic environment. No other details were given. As of 2018, Victoriabank is part of Romania's largest financial group, Banca Transilvania. Victoriabank's largest shareholders are Banca Transilvania from Romania and the European Bank for Reconstruction and Development through the Dutch company VB Investment Holding BV, which owns 72.19% of the Moldovan bank's shares. // 05.12.2024 - InfoMarket
